Prepaid services have grown far beyond the basic “pay-as-you-go” concept. Today, they offer:
No contracts – Switch providers whenever you want.
Upfront pricing – No hidden fees.
Flexibility – Adjust your plan monthly.
Accessibility – Perfect for students, renters, travelers, and seasonal residents.

Prepaid phone plans in 2025 often include features once reserved for postpaid contracts—like unlimited data and hotspot usage.
AT&T Prepaid – Flexible plans with rollover data.
Verizon Prepaid – Nationwide coverage with 5G access.
Mint Mobile – Affordable multi-month plans.

Cutting the cord has never been easier. Prepaid TV options let you stream what you love without the pressure of a contract.
YouTube TV Prepaid – Live TV with sports, movies, and local channels.
Sling TV – Affordable custom channel bundles.
Hulu + Live TV – On-demand content plus live channels.

Even with prepaid services, prices can change over time. One of the smartest moves is to lock in low rates after a promotional offer ends by:
Renewing before the promo expires
Asking about loyalty discounts
Watching for seasonal promotions
